How to Access BBC World News Today Radio

Live Broadcasts: One of the easiest ways to listen to BBC World News Today Radio is through its live broadcasts. You can access these broadcasts online via the BBC website or through various radio apps. The BBC website offers a streaming service that allows you to listen to the radio program in real-time, no matter where you are in the world. Simply visit the BBC World Service website and click on the “Listen Live” button. Alternatively, you can download radio apps like TuneIn Radio or BBC Sounds, which offer access to BBC World News Today Radio and other BBC radio programs. These apps are available for both iOS and Android devices, making it easy to listen on your smartphone or tablet. Listening to live broadcasts ensures you're getting the latest news as it breaks.

BBC Sounds App: The BBC Sounds app is your one-stop-shop for all things BBC Radio. This app not only allows you to listen to live broadcasts and podcasts but also offers a range of other features, such as on-demand programs, curated playlists, and personalized recommendations. With the BBC Sounds app, you can easily find and listen to BBC World News Today Radio, as well as explore other BBC radio programs that might interest you. The app is available for free on both iOS and Android devices and offers a user-friendly interface that makes it easy to navigate and discover new content.
